Bare interlinked is the recommended human first run: it presents the local
enforcement posture, then composes the underlying install/configuration
commands. enable is the explicit install primitive and is preferable for
automation. Both install hooks and skills and start the daemon.

Most guard, quality, activity, and maintenance commands work locally. The coordination commands require a configured Interlinked MCP Server; consult the generated reference for the exact connectivity and option contract of a specific command.
